Not Mounting Your Dishwasher Correctly Can Bring About a Hill of Problems


Not only can setting up a dish washer appropriately invalidate your service warranty, yet it can additionally produce a mess. As an example, if you do not set up the supply line properly, you could deal with leakages-- and even worse, a flood. You could likewise experience a "water hammer"-- when the water runs also rapidly with your pipes and also causes loud drinking noises. Lastly, if you inaccurately install your dish washer to the waste disposal unit, you may see pungent scents or have residue on your meals.

Setting Up a Dishwashing Machine Needs a Range of Equipments


If you do not have a selection of devices on hand, you may need to make a trip to Lowe's or Home Depot. To set up a dish washer, you need the complying with devices: pliers, an adjustable wrench, a collection of screwdrivers, a tube cutter, and opening saws.

A Plumber Can Evaluate the Supply Lines


A supply line, especially a dishwasher adapter, attaches the dishwashing machine to a water source. A plumber can make certain that the line is compatible with both your dishwashing machine and water source if you get a new supply line. If you decide to use an existing supply line, a specialist plumber can inspect it to guarantee that it's in good condition as well as does not have any type of leaks.

SINK AND DISHWASHER INSTALLATION


If you want to relocate the sink and dishwasher, major plumbing work needs to be done. The sink needs an access point to both hot and cold water, which connects from the faucets and a waste-pipe. Your dishwasher calls for the same type of plumbing work. The water supply and waste-pipe access are extended from the sink to the dishwasher, which is why these two appliances need to be placed next to each other.


If you're simply looking to have a new sink installed in the same location, less professional work needs to be done, meaning your bill will be significantly cheaper. When shopping for a new sink, consider upgrading to features like extensions, sprayers, soap dispensers and a stainless steel garbage disposal.
